David beats Goliath
West Caldwell – June 10 2018: The Florham Park Landsharks bite back with their biggest upset ever against the CWC Cougars! After the Cougars posted a 4-0 win against the Landsharks at home on the large 9×9 field under the lights on Thursday night, the Cougars were 6-0 with 27 Goals and only one goal let up. The Landsharks traveled to the Cougars home field for the second match of the series. Before the game started the coaches were optimistic that the Landsharks could put up a fight against this Goliath.
Light rain was falling at kickoff as the Landsharks came out strong and scored a quick goal (Ally Massarano). The landsharks conintued to play strong and went into the half tied at 1-1. Coach Kevin (our trainer) who came to the game to see his team play gave a very good half time talk to the team with some great feedback on positioning and things the Landsharks needed to improve on. The Landsharks came out biting and scored the next two goals (Caitlyn Fenyk (2)) to take a 3-1 lead. Could the LandSharks hang on and beat this Goliath?? Short answer – YES! The land sharks held on and gave the Cougars their first loss of the season with a 3-2 win. The Landsharks raise their record to 5-3 with two games remaining in the spring season.
Astrid Yougren and Parv Chiarella played a strong games in the forward position.
The Midfield was Played tough by Caitlyn Fenyk, Olivia Franco, Tori Henning and Ally Massarano.
Defensively, Ally Burmeister, Camran Sward, and Avi “Speedster” Tenore did their jobs and held the Cougars.
In Goal Patsy Shallis was a beast with numerous saves and steady goal play.
